[POWERPC] Convert powermac ide blink to new led infrastructure

This patch removes the old pmac ide led blink code and
adds generic LED subsystem support for the LED.

It maintains backward compatibility with the old
BLK_DEV_IDE_PMAC_BLINK Kconfig option which now
simply selects the new code and influences the
default trigger.

config ADB_PMU_LED
bool "Support for the Power/iBook front LED"
depends on ADB_PMU
select LEDS_CLASS
help
Support the front LED on Power/iBooks as a generic LED that can
be triggered by any of the supported triggers. To get the
behaviour of the old CONFIG_BLK_DEV_IDE_PMAC_BLINK, select this
and the ide-disk LED trigger and configure appropriately through
sysfs.

#include <linux/types.h>
#include <linux/kernel.h>
#include <linux/device.h>
#include <linux/leds.h>
#include <linux/adb.h>
#include <linux/pmu.h>
#include <asm/prom.h>
static spinlock_t pmu_blink_lock;
static struct adb_request pmu_blink_req;
/* -1: no change, 0: request off, 1: request on */
static int requested_change;
static int sleeping;
static void pmu_req_done(struct adb_request * req)
{
unsigned long flags;
spin_lock_irqsave(&pmu_blink_lock, flags);
/* if someone requested a change in the meantime
* (we only see the last one which is fine)
* then apply it now */
if (requested_change != -1 && !sleeping)
pmu_request(&pmu_blink_req, NULL, 4, 0xee, 4, 0, requested_change);
/* reset requested change */
requested_change = -1;
spin_unlock_irqrestore(&pmu_blink_lock, flags);
}
static void pmu_led_set(struct led_classdev *led_cdev,
enum led_brightness brightness)
{
unsigned long flags;
spin_lock_irqsave(&pmu_blink_lock, flags);
switch (brightness) {
case LED_OFF:
requested_change = 0;
break;
case LED_FULL:
requested_change = 1;
break;
default:
goto out;
break;
}
/* if request isn't done, then don't do anything */
if (pmu_blink_req.complete && !sleeping)
pmu_request(&pmu_blink_req, NULL, 4, 0xee, 4, 0, requested_change);
out:
spin_unlock_irqrestore(&pmu_blink_lock, flags);
}
static struct led_classdev pmu_led = {
.name = "pmu-front-led",
#ifdef CONFIG_BLK_DEV_IDE_PMAC_BLINK
.default_trigger = "ide-disk",
#endif
.brightness_set = pmu_led_set,
};
#ifdef CONFIG_PM
static int pmu_led_sleep_call(struct pmu_sleep_notifier *self, int when)
{
unsigned long flags;
spin_lock_irqsave(&pmu_blink_lock, flags);
switch (when) {
case PBOOK_SLEEP_REQUEST:
sleeping = 1;
break;
case PBOOK_WAKE:
sleeping = 0;
break;
default:
/* do nothing */
break;
}
spin_unlock_irqrestore(&pmu_blink_lock, flags);
return PBOOK_SLEEP_OK;
}
static struct pmu_sleep_notifier via_pmu_led_sleep_notif = {
.notifier_call = pmu_led_sleep_call,
};
#endif
static int __init via_pmu_led_init(void)
{
struct device_node *dt;
const char *model;
/* only do this on keylargo based models */
if (pmu_get_model() != PMU_KEYLARGO_BASED)
return -ENODEV;
dt = of_find_node_by_path("/");
if (dt == NULL)
return -ENODEV;
model = (const char *)get_property(dt, "model", NULL);
if (model == NULL)
return -ENODEV;
if (strncmp(model, "PowerBook", strlen("PowerBook")) != 0 &&
strncmp(model, "iBook", strlen("iBook")) != 0) {
of_node_put(dt);
/* ignore */
return -ENODEV;
}
of_node_put(dt);
spin_lock_init(&pmu_blink_lock);
/* no outstanding req */
pmu_blink_req.complete = 1;
pmu_blink_req.done = pmu_req_done;
#ifdef CONFIG_PM
pmu_register_sleep_notifier(&via_pmu_led_sleep_notif);
#endif
return led_classdev_register(NULL, &pmu_led);
}
late_initcall(via_pmu_led_init);
